LLong story short, i looked for a good amplifier, not too expensive to drive my AN-J speakers and i decided to go with an ATC P1 Amplifier recommended by stereophile. There not a lot of information on the Audiogon Forum, so i decided to share my experience with you.

I received the P1 one week ago. The cabling between the preamp and the amp is a long distance unbalanced cable (50 Ft). I precise here, that the cables between the Preamp and Amp was also brand new.

Impression after after 100 hours

Sound test just after cabling the system : horrible (no Bass, super cold, no soundstage, ect….)

After 20 hours : Bass appears but very tiny, still no soundstage.

After 40 hours : Bass continue to grow, soundstage appears, sound begin to be more smooth

After 60 hours : Bass is here but not deep. I decide to change the position of the AN-J (very close to the back wall). Sound Better.

After 100 hours : Bass is more deep but don't start before 125 hz, it's probably a speaker limitation. Soundstage is more and more open and deep, sound is crystal clear in high frequency, smooth and super details.

Now, back to the P1. After 150 hours the sound i now open, deep, with a good soundstage. I am not sure if the sound will continue to change but it seem to be stable. I am really impress by this little amplifier. It's not dry, or difficult to listen. The sound is warm, really quick, and neutral. Woow.

The match with the Audio Note AN-J speakers is perfect.

What about the bass ? The bass is now totally in place. I have a little drop from 125 hz to 20 hz, but with a bookshelf speakers it's normal. I will adjust that with a subwoofer.
